Facebook Chatbot Persistent Меню dosn't работы (требуется параметр setting_type)

голоса
1

В настоящее время я пытаюсь реализовать Persistent меню для моего Facebook Chatbot. К сожалению, есть два (совершенно разные) документации для осуществления которой оба не работают для меня. (Оба должны работать API v2.6)

https://developers.facebook.com/docs/messenger-platform/messenger-profile/persistent-menu https://developers.facebook.com/docs/messenger-platform/thread-settings/persistent-menu

Я использовал этот простой вызов , который возвращается ошибка (# 100) требуется Параметр setting_type

curl -X POST -H Content-Type: application/json -d '{
  persistent_menu:[
    {
    call_to_actions:[
        {
          type:web_url,
          title:Einstellungen,
          url:https://`url-part`.cloudfront.net/,
          webview_height_ratio:full
        }
      ]
    },
    {
      locale:de_DE,
      composer_input_disabled:false
    }
  ]
}' https://graph.facebook.com/v2.6/me/thread_settings?access_token=`token`

Если я использую второй документации с setting_type : call_to_actionsпроисходит та же ошибка. Может быть , кто - нибудь может объяснить мне , почему я наклоняю настроить Persistent меню? Было бы хорошо , чтобы получить некоторую помощь.

Всего наилучшего

Даниил

Задан 06/05/2017 в 13:27
источник пользователем
На других языках...                            


1 ответов

голоса
5

Ниже работает для меня.

Убедитесь , что вы отправляете запрос на новую конечную точку messenger_profile. Вы должны обеспечить , по меньшей мере , локаль по умолчанию.

curl -X POST -H "Content-Type: application/json" -d '{
  "persistent_menu":[
    {
    "locale":"default",
    "composer_input_disabled":false,
    "call_to_actions":[
        {
          "type":"web_url",
          "title":"Einstellungen",
          "url":"https://`url-part`.cloudfront.net",
          "webview_height_ratio":"full"
        }
      ]
    }
  ]
}' "https://graph.facebook.com/v2.6/me/messenger_profile?access_token=`token`"
Ответил 07/05/2017 в 02:21
источник пользователем

Cookies help us deliver our services. By using our services, you agree to our use of cookies. Learn more